BCNET is next week from April 1-3, 2025! We want to wish all attending an insightful experience filled with new learning, valuable connections and innovative ideas.

There will be a significant number of presenters from UBC, featuring topics like AI, data governance, automation and cybersecurity. Larry Bouthillier (Director, Extended Learning) and Paul Soo (Associate Director, Organization Learning & Leadership Development, UBC HR ) will also be debuting UBC IT's AI training framework (a collaboration between UBC IT, HR and Extended Learning), and introducing the launch of the UBC AI Professionals Certificate Program offered by Extended Learning in their session Empowering Staff: Designing an AI Training Program for a Smarter Campus.
